Kirksville Police and the Adair County Sheriff’s Office are beginning an investigation after a missing woman was found dead in Kirksville Wednesday afternoon. A search for 55-year old Meredith Ann Water Lewis begin earlier in the week after a member of Lewis’ family contacted the Kirksville Police Department to report they hadn’t seen her since last week. They also reported Lewis had been dealing with health problems and were concerned for her well-being. Lewis had last been seen October 30th at approximately 5:35 pm in the area of Highway P and the Highway 63 bypass after being dropped off at that location. Adair County Sheriff Robert Hardwick says she was found dead not far from that area.

Lewis’ body was discovered by Kirksville police officers and a member of the Adair County Sheriff’s Office assisting in the search. Hardwick says the investigation into her death is now underway.
